textarea的使用
一、前言
在Web开发中,我们经常会需要文本输入框来让用户输入文本内容,而HTML提供的textarea就是一个很好的选择。textarea的使用非常灵活,可以满足各种需求。本文将介绍textarea的使用方法和一些常见的应用场景。
二、textarea的基本使用
1. 如何定义一个textarea
在HTML中,我们可以通过以下代码对textarea进行定义:
```html
<textarea></textarea>
```
2. textarea的属性
textarea中cols表示textarea的常用属性如下:
- name:指定textarea的名称;
- rows、cols:指定textarea的行数和列数;
- placeholder:指定textarea的默认提示文字;
- readonly:指定textarea只读;
- disabled:禁用textarea;
- autofocus:指定页面加载后,textarea自动获得焦点。
下面是一个完整的textarea定义:
```html
<textarea name="message" rows="5" cols="50" placeholder="请输入留言内容"></textarea>
```
三、textarea的常见应用场景
1. 留言板
textarea的一个常见用途是实现留言板。我们可以通过textarea让用户输入留言内容,并将其保存到服务器上,再通过页面展示给其他用户看。
2. 文本编辑器
textarea也可以用于实现文本编辑器。我们可以在textarea外层包裹一些样式和脚本,来实现更加丰富的文本编辑功能,比如:字体、大小、颜、加粗、斜体、删除线、插入图片等等。
3. 代码编辑器
对于一些技术人员而言,代码编辑器也是非常重要的。textarea可以用于实现代码编辑器,我们可以在textarea内部通过JavaScript来处理代码高亮、自动缩进、自动补全等功能。
4. 邮件正文
在编写邮件时,我们经常需要输入大段的文字。textarea可以很好地满足这种需求,我们可以通过CSS来调整textarea的样式,让邮件的排版更加美观。
四、结语
textarea是一种非常常见的Web元素,它提供了很多灵活的功能,能够满足各种需求。在使用textarea时,我们需要注意一些细节,比如:行数和列数的设定、默认提示文字的使用等等。不仅如此,我们还可以将textarea与CSS、JavaScript等技术进行结合,实现更加丰富的功能。相信通过本文的介绍,读者已经对textarea有了更加深入的了解。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论